One which I deal with in on a somewhat regular basis. Treasury notes have 3 primary risk factors (called shift, twist and butterfly). These are in fact all dimension of interest rate risk. However, once you have determined the factor loading for any given security, it behaves as a linear factor.
You and your strategy team work out an ideal risk profile based on your outlook for the market and have balanced your portfolio accordingly. The next day a client gives you $10 million to be put into the fund. Pick 3 treasury notes, calculate their factor loading, and determine how much of each you need to buy to bring your exposures back to target.
